Climate Data for Latitude 61.25 Longitude 21.25

Köppen climate classification: Dfb (Climate: snow; Precipitation: fully humid; Temperature: warm summer)

Averages (English) Metric

TypeUnitsJanFebMarAprMayJunJulAugSepOctNovDecPeriod
Min Temp16.115.020.129.437.646.452.551.144.336.528.220.8108 years
Mean Temp21.721.127.136.746.955.460.958.950.941.632.525.9109 years
Max Temp27.227.334.244.056.264.769.566.957.846.736.931.0103 years
FrostDays31.028.231.030.026.910.71.34.18.328.730.031.0109 years
WetDays18.113.512.410.78.610.512.213.115.415.517.920.1109 years
Precipitationin1.20.91.01.11.31.82.42.72.12.02.01.5109 years
